I just purchased a ZAMP suitcase and I would like to keep it from wondering off to a new owner. What is the best way to prevent this other than locking it away every time we leave the trailer on it's own?
I have both a generator and a solar panell. The generator is secured with a high security chain that you buy at a logging supply that can only be cut with a power saw.
The solar panel has no way to secure it so a guard dog, shotgun, use a regular type bicycle cable lock and hope for the best.
I have a 50' X 1/8" steel cable that came off a small ATV winch. I drilled a hole in the frame of the zamp and attach the cable with a long shackle master lock. The cable has eyelets in each end, one small enough to pass through the other so the opposite end can be looped around a tree or whatever. Not theft proof, but might prevent a walk off.
